天津阿里云代理商:ado 操作mysql数据库步骤

使用ADO操作MySQL数据库的步骤如下:

  1. 引入必要的ADO对象库:在编程环境中引入ADO对象库,例如在VBScript中使用<%%% Set conn = Server.CreateObject("ADODB.Connection") %%%>进行引入。
  2. 创建数据库连接对象:使用CreateObject方法创建一个ADODB.Connection对象,例如Set conn = CreateObject("ADODB.Connection")
  3. 设置数据库连接字符串:使用ConnectionString属性设置数据库的连接字符串。连接字符串的格式通常为Provider=MySQL;Server=服务器地址;Database=数据库名;User ID=用户名;Password=密码;,例conn.ConnectionString = "Driver={MySQL ODBC 8.0 UNICODE Driver};Server=127.0.0.1;Database=test;User ID=root;Password=123456;"
  4. 打开数据库连接:使用Open方法打开数据库连接,例如conn.Open
  5. 创建并执行SQL语句:使用CreateObject方法创建一个ADODB.Command对象,并设置其ActiveConnection属性为已创建的数据库连接对象。然后使用CommandText属性设置需要执行的SQL语句,例如Set cmd = CreateObject("ADODB.Command")cmd.ActiveConnection = conncmd.CommandText = "SELECT * FROM 表名"
  6. 处理查询结果:使用Execute方法执行SQL语句,并将结果存储在一个ADODB.Recordset对象中。例如Set rs = cmd.Execute
  7. 遍历查询结果:使用rs.EOFrs.MoveNext方法配合循环遍历Recordset对象的所有记录,并通过rs.Fields属性获取每条记录的字段值。例如:

    Do Until rs.EOF
    FieldValue = rs.Fields("字段名").Value
    rs.MoveNext
    Loop
  8. 关闭数据库连接:使用Close方法关闭数据库连接,例如conn.Close

以上就是使用ADO操作MySQL数据库的一般步骤,可以根据实际需要对这些步骤进行适当的调整和扩展。

使用ADO(ActiveX Data Objects)操作MySQL数据库的步骤如下:

  1. 引入ADO库文件
    在代码文件的开头引入ADODB库文件,以便使用ADO相关的对象和方法:

    import ADODB
  2. 创建数据库连接对象
    创建ADODB.Connection对象,用于与数据库建立连接:

    Dim conn As New ADODB.Connection
  3. 设置连接字符串
    使用连接字符串指定数据库连接信息,包括数据库类型、地址、用户名、密码等:

    conn.ConnectionString = "DRIVER={MySQL ODBC 8.0 Unicode Driver};SERVER=数据库地址;DATABASE=数据库名;UID=用户名;PWD=密码;"
  4. 打开数据库连接
    使用Open方法打开数据库连接:

    conn.Open
  5. 执行SQL语句
    使用Execute方法执行SQL语句,包括查询、插入、更新、删除等操作:

    Dim cmd As New ADODB.Command
    cmd.CommandText = "SQL语句"
    cmd.ActiveConnection = conn
    cmd.Execute

    也可以使用记录集(Recordset)对象返回查询结果:

    天津阿里云代理商:ado 操作mysql数据库步骤
    Dim rs As New ADODB.Recordset
    rs.Open "SELECT * FROM 表名", conn
  6. 关闭数据库连接
    使用Close方法关闭数据库连接:

    conn.Close

以上是使用ADO操作MySQL数据库的基本步骤,根据具体需求和情况,可以进行相应的调整和扩展。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/138110.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年2月5日 01:29
下一篇 2024年2月5日 01:43

相关推荐

  • 腾讯云语音合成软件

    腾讯云语音合成软件是一种能够将文字转换成语音的技术。腾讯云提供了一套语音合成API,开发者可以通过调用该API来将文本转换成自然流畅的语音。腾讯云语音合成软件可以应用于多个领域,例如智能客服、语音助手、在线教育等。用户可以根据需求选择不同的声音和语速,并且还可以将语音保存为音频文件进行后续应用。腾讯云语音合成软件具备高质量、高性能、高稳定性的特点,可以帮助开…

    2023年8月24日
    64700
  • 云数据库备份与恢复阿里云

    阿里云如何还原数据库? 你说的是rds还是自己安装的数据库,还是程序里面的还原功能。1、rds的在后台上传备份文件,直接还原。2、自己在ecs里面安装的,根据是mssql,mysql的操作,百度相关即可。3、程序的比如wordpress,直接在wp后台还原里面导入还原文件。 我用的是阿里云linux服务器,数据库是MySQL,怎样用备份数据,恢复数据库呢备份…

    2023年8月26日
    89300
  • 南城阿里云企业邮箱代理商:阿里邮箱企业版怎么设置中文版

    阿里云企业邮箱代理商:阿里邮箱企业版中文版设置 阿里云企业邮箱是一款全方位的企业级电子邮件解决方案,它具备许多优势和特点。 阿里云企业邮箱的优势 安全可靠:阿里云企业邮箱基于大规模集群架构,具备强大的防护能力,保障企业邮件的安全性。 灵活易用:提供简单易用的管理控制台,管理员可以轻松管理企业邮箱,包括用户管理、域名管理等。 高效稳定:采用分布式部署,负载均衡…

    2024年1月30日
    64700
  • 上海阿里云代理商:阿里云存储12.12活动

    阿里云是中国领先的云计算服务提供商,拥有全球超过70个可用区域和超过300个云产品和服务。作为阿里云的代理商,我们非常高兴为您介绍阿里云在12月12日的存储活动。 在阿里云的12.12存储活动中,您可以享受到以下优惠: 存储产品折扣:阿里云提供各种类型的存储产品,包括对象存储、文件存储、块存储等。在12.12活动中,这些存储产品会有折扣优惠,您可以获得更实惠…

    2023年12月15日
    70200
  • 腾讯云计算对比阿里巴巴

    阿里云和腾讯云服务器区别在哪?相互优势都是什么? 腾讯云相比阿里云没什么优势。阿里云比腾讯云完善些,功能更多可用性更强。但腾讯云不是单纯卖云服务的,它是捆绑销售的,凡是要接入腾讯的生态(比如微信、QQ空间等)必须得用腾讯云服务器,靠着这个强制条款腾讯迅速发展壮大。腾讯云也在慢慢完善,大多数应用场景也都能满足,但就是对很多新技术的支持总是比阿里云慢一些,高级的…

    2023年8月29日
    66100

发表回复

登录后才能评论

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/